PFAS Analysis by U.S. EPA Method OTM-45 for Emissions

03 Oct 2025

feature EVAR4287
  • Sample Matrix: emissions from stationary sources
  • Sample Preparation: WAX solid-phase extraction
  • Detection Technique: LC-MS/MS

Other Test Method 45 (OTM-45) Measurement of Selected Per- and Polyfluorinated Alkyl Substances from Stationary Sources

U.S. EPA Method OTM-45 is a performance-based draft method that can be used for the analysis of 50 PFAS in air emissions from stationary sources. It combines solid-phase extraction sample preparation using weak anion exchange (WAX) cartridges with LC-MS/MS analysis on a C18 column. Draft Method OTM-45 was released to encourage a consistent process for facilities, stationary source test teams, research laboratories, and other stakeholders and to promote discussion and further evaluation of the method. Analyte List for EPA Method OTM-45 for PFAS Analysis

PFAS acronyms, compound names, and CAS numbers vary across methods and guidelines, and they also depend on compound form (e.g., neutral vs. salt). The following list uses standardized terminology to allow easy comparison across the methods and guidelines in our comprehensive guide. Please refer to U.S. EPA Method OTM-45 for method-specific nomenclature.
